ICYMI, President Duterte went full-on rage mode during his late-night presidential address earlier last night, highlighting misogynistic and downright inaccurate claims against VP Leni Robredo.
Among his many false remarks was that Robredo wasn’t doing anything to aid calamity victims and that she joined in the #NasaanAngPangulo Twitter trend. Of course, he had to sprinkle a bit of misogyny in there. With his recent post-typhoon sex jokes, it’s not a surprise.
Duterte spends first 20 minutes of his address criticizing Robredo, and ends with these words: Gusto kong malaman, ikaw, gab-gabi lumalakad ka, anong oras ka umuuwi? At kaninong bahay ka tumutuloy?

Duterte’s address has since prompted the top hashtag #DuterteMeltdown with over 56.1K tweets as of writing.
PH wit isn’t done just yet though, as the hashtags #NaasarAngPangulo and #NasiraanAngPangulo have also been making their way to Twitter PH’s trending topics. The two rising hashtags are a clear twist on #NasaanAngPangulo to reflect the pvblic call for government action amidst the ongoing calamities.
